I Don'T Have A Story To Tell Poem by Sheikh Ahmed Tijan Bah

I have a story to tell
No, I'm just kidding; I'm just looking for something to sell
And since what I do is poetry
Good merchandise would be a story
But I really have none
So I'm sitting here staring at the Sun
No, I'm kidding again, its evening
And besides, i couldn't stare at the sun if it was shinning

But this has got me thinking
What am I doing?
I'm a poet that doesn't write about his feelings
And I'm still a kid so I don't have many dealings
I only write when I have an inspiration
And lately something seems to be wrong with my imagination
May be I haven't served it, its favorite dish
Or maybe it just wants a kiss

So I guess I'm only left with narration of a story
Let me check with my memory
"Story compartment of memory is empty"
But my life is not empty
How comes I have no story worth narrating
May be my childhood, needs revisiting

Vroom! ! ! gone and back
"99999 stories found, arranged in a stack"
So what is the problem?
Why can't I narrate them?
"They are not worthy"
Wow! Wait, I got it!

Remember that time I didn't have a poem to write?
And I sat on my chair thinking of what to write
"Yes, so, what about it? "
If I wrote about that, it would be a hit
I remember it all, I can write all down
"Yes, but dude, that's this poem you are writing right now"
